Το WebRTC (Web Real-Time Communication) είναι μια τεχνολογία ανοιχτού κώδικα που επιτρέπει την επικοινωνία peer-to-peer σε προγράμματα περιήγησης ιστού και παρόμοιες εφαρμογές.
Αρχικά κυκλοφόρησε το 2011, το WebRTC εξαλείφει την ανάγκη για προσθήκες προγράμματος περιήγησης και λογισμικό τρίτων κατασκευαστών. Εάν έχετε χρησιμοποιήσει ποτέ το Discord ή το Google Hangouts, για παράδειγμα, έχετε χρησιμοποιήσει μια υπηρεσία που υποστηρίζεται από WebRTC.
Αλλά υπάρχει ένα πρόβλημα με το WebRTC: η πιθανότητα διαρροής διεύθυνσης IP.
Τι είναι η διαρροή WebRTC;
Οι τεχνολογικοί γίγαντες όπως η Google, η Microsoft και η Apple χρησιμοποιούν το WebRTC. Τα περισσότερα προγράμματα περιήγησης στις μέρες μας χρησιμοποιούν επίσης αυτήν την τεχνολογία, πράγμα που σημαίνει ότι υπάρχει πάντα πιθανότητα η διεύθυνση IP σας (μια σειρά χαρακτήρων μοναδικών για τον υπολογιστή ή το δίκτυό σας) να διαρρεύσει χωρίς να το γνωρίζετε. Τι είναι όμως ακριβώς οι διαρροές WebRTC και πώς θα πραγματοποιηθεί;
Ας υποθέσουμε ότι χρησιμοποιείτε ένα VPN για να περιηγηθείτε στο Διαδίκτυο, είτε για να προστατεύσετε το απόρρητό σας είτε απλώς επειδή πρέπει να παρακάμψετε τους γεωγραφικούς περιορισμούς. Ένα καλό VPN χρησιμοποιεί ισχυρή κρυπτογράφηση, συσκοτίζει την πραγματική σας διεύθυνση IP, και πλαστογραφεί την τοποθεσία σας, κάνοντάς την να φαίνεται ότι κατοικείτε σε διαφορετική χώρα και έτσι προστατεύετε το απόρρητό σας.
Αλλά ακόμα και με ενεργοποιημένο ένα VPN, ένα πρόγραμμα περιήγησης που χρησιμοποιεί τεχνολογία WebRTC μπορεί να διαρρέει την πραγματική σας διεύθυνση IP. Επομένως, εάν προσπαθείτε να συνομιλήσετε μέσω βίντεο με κάποιον μέσω του προγράμματος περιήγησής σας ή να μιλήσετε μέσω του Google Hangouts, το WebRTC ενδέχεται να παρακάμπτει τις προστασίες που έχετε θέσει και να διαρρέει την πραγματική σας διεύθυνση IP.
Οι διαρροές WebRTC δεν αναιρούν απλώς τον σκοπό χρήσης ενός VPN, αλλά αντιπροσωπεύουν επίσης μια σημαντική ασφάλεια ευπάθεια που θα μπορούσε να εκμεταλλευτεί ένας ικανός παράγοντας απειλής, εάν υποκλέψει τις επικοινωνίες σας με κάποιο τρόπο. Για παράδειγμα, μπορεί να εκκινήσουν ένα Επίθεση πλαστογράφησης IP και αναπτύξτε κακόβουλο λογισμικό στον υπολογιστή σας.
Πώς να ελέγξετε εάν το WebRTC διαρρέει την πραγματική σας διεύθυνση IP
Εάν δεν έχετε εγκατεστημένο λογισμικό VPN, η πραγματική σας διεύθυνση IP είναι ορατή ανεξάρτητα από το πρόγραμμα περιήγησης ή τη συσκευή που χρησιμοποιείτε. Όμως, όπως εξηγήθηκε παραπάνω, ακόμα κι αν το VPN σας είναι ενεργοποιημένο, η διεύθυνση IP σας μπορεί να είναι ορατή λόγω διαρροής WebRTC.
Δείτε πώς μπορείτε να ελέγξετε εάν η IP σας έχει διαρροή.
Το πρώτο πράγμα που πρέπει να κάνετε είναι να αποσυνδέσετε το VPN σας και, στη συνέχεια, να κατευθυνθείτε σε έναν ιστότοπο όπως WhatIsMyIP—εδώ, μπορείτε εύκολα να ελέγξετε ποια είναι η πραγματική σας διεύθυνση IP.
Αφού το κάνετε αυτό, ενεργοποιήστε το VPN σας και μεταβείτε στο BrowserLeaks. Αυτό είναι ένα δωρεάν διαδικτυακό εργαλείο που μπορεί να χρησιμοποιήσει ο καθένας για να δοκιμάσει το πρόγραμμα περιήγησής του για διαφορετικούς τύπους ζητημάτων ασφάλειας και απορρήτου. Μόλις μεταβείτε στον ιστότοπο του BrowserLeaks, μεταβείτε σε Δοκιμή διαρροής WebRTC. Κάντε κλικ στον υπερσύνδεσμο και αφήστε τη σελίδα να φορτώσει. Η πραγματική σας διεύθυνση IP θα εμφανιστεί εδώ.
Αυτό που πρέπει να κάνετε στη συνέχεια είναι να επαναλάβετε τη διαδικασία με ενεργοποιημένο το VPN σας. Έτσι, ενεργοποιήστε το VPN σας, μεταβείτε στο BrowserLeaks και ξεκινήστε ξανά το WebRTC Leak Test. Εάν το VPN σας κάνει τη δουλειά του σωστά, η πραγματική σας διεύθυνση IP δεν θα είναι ορατή.
Αυτή η δοκιμή πραγματοποιήθηκε στο ProtonVPN, το οποίο —όπως μπορείτε να δείτε παρακάτω— δεν φαίνεται ευάλωτο σε διαρροές WebRTC. Αντί να δείχνει την πραγματική μας διεύθυνση IP, δείχνει τη διεύθυνση IP ενός τυχαίου διακομιστή στον οποίο συνδέθηκε στην Ολλανδία.
Προφανώς, χρησιμοποιώντας α ασφαλές και αξιόπιστο VPN είναι ένας καλός τρόπος για να αποτρέψετε τις διαρροές WebRTC, αλλά για να εξασφαλίσετε τη μέγιστη προστασία θα πρέπει να απενεργοποιήσετε το WebRTC στο πρόγραμμα περιήγησής σας.
Πώς να απενεργοποιήσετε το WebRTC στο πρόγραμμα περιήγησής σας
Τα καλά νέα είναι ότι είναι δυνατό να απενεργοποιήσετε το WebRTC σε πολλά δημοφιλή προγράμματα περιήγησης και έτσι να αποτρέψετε τις διαρροές. Δείτε πώς μπορείτε να απενεργοποιήσετε το WebRTC σε Chrome, Firefox και Safari.
Πώς να απενεργοποιήσετε το WebRTC στο Chrome
Δεν είναι δυνατή η μη αυτόματη απενεργοποίηση του WebRTC στο πρόγραμμα περιήγησης Chrome. Ωστόσο, υπάρχουν αρκετές δωρεάν επεκτάσεις που μπορούν να κάνουν ακριβώς αυτό. Το WebRTC Leak Prevent είναι ένα από αυτά. Είναι διαθέσιμο στο Chrome Web Store, και θα πρέπει να λειτουργεί στα περισσότερα προγράμματα περιήγησης που βασίζονται στο Chromium, συμπεριλαμβανομένου του Brave. Το μόνο που χρειάζεται να κάνετε είναι να εγκαταστήσετε την επέκταση και να την ενεργοποιήσετε.
Πώς να απενεργοποιήσετε το WebRTC στον Firefox
Εάν χρησιμοποιείτε Firefox, εκκινήστε το πρόγραμμα περιήγησης και πληκτρολογήστε "about: config" στη γραμμή διευθύνσεων και πατήστε Εισαγω. Εάν δείτε μια σελίδα προειδοποίησης, κάντε κλικ στο Αποδεχτείτε τον κίνδυνο και συνεχίστε κουμπί. Στη συνέχεια, πληκτρολογήστε "media.peerconnection.enabled" στο πλαίσιο αναζήτησης. Αλλάξτε την τιμή από αληθής προς την ψευδής πατώντας το κουμπί εναλλαγής.
Πώς να απενεργοποιήσετε το WebRTC στο Safari
Εάν χρησιμοποιείτε το Safari, μπορείτε να απενεργοποιήσετε το WebRTC στο Προτιμήσεις μενού. Μόλις το εισαγάγετε, μεταβείτε στο Προχωρημένος καρτέλα στο κάτω μέρος και ελέγξτε το Εμφάνιση του μενού Ανάπτυξη στη γραμμή μενού κουτί. Μετά από αυτό, κάντε κλικ Αναπτύξτε και επιλέξτε Πειραματικές λειτουργίες. Εύρημα WebRTC mDNS ICEυποψηφίουςκαι κάντε κλικ σε αυτό για να απενεργοποιήσετε το WebRTC.
Απενεργοποίηση WebRTC: Τι πρέπει να έχετε κατά νου
Αφού απενεργοποιήσετε το WebRTC στο πρόγραμμα περιήγησής σας, μεταβείτε ξανά στο BrowserLeaks για να ελέγξετε εάν η διεύθυνση IP σας διαρρέει. Πραγματοποιήστε τη δοκιμή με και χωρίς ενεργοποιημένο το VPN σας. Εάν ακολουθήσατε τα βήματα που περιγράφονται παραπάνω, η πραγματική σας διεύθυνση IP δεν θα πρέπει να είναι ορατή στο WebRTC Leak Test του BrowserLeaks.
Ωστόσο, έχετε κατά νου ότι η απενεργοποίηση του WebRTC στο πρόγραμμα περιήγησής σας δεν έρχεται χωρίς τα μειονεκτήματά του. Κάτι τέτοιο μπορεί να προκαλέσει δυσλειτουργία ή μη λειτουργία ιστότοπων και υπηρεσιών που χρησιμοποιούν τεχνολογία WebRTC. Σε κάθε περίπτωση, μπορείτε να ανατρέξετε σε αυτόν τον οδηγό και να ενεργοποιήσετε ή να απενεργοποιήσετε το WebRTC όπως το κρίνετε κατάλληλο.
Η χρήση ενός καλού VPN και η απενεργοποίηση του WebRTC είναι σίγουρα βήματα προς τη σωστή κατεύθυνση, εάν θέλετε να ενισχύσετε την ασφάλεια και το απόρρητό σας. Αλλά υπάρχουν άλλα πράγματα που μπορείτε να κάνετε για να προστατεύσετε τον εαυτό σας στο διαδίκτυο. εναλλαγή από Chrome ή Microsoft Edge σε α πιο ασφαλές πρόγραμμα περιήγησης, ξεκινήστε να χρησιμοποιείτε κρυπτογραφημένες υπηρεσίες email και εφαρμογές συνομιλίας και εξοικειωθείτε με το Tor.
Αποτρέψτε τις διαρροές WebRTC για να παραμείνετε ασφαλείς
Το WebRTC είναι ένα φιλόδοξο έργο που πιθανότατα θα παραμείνει για τα επόμενα χρόνια. Όσο χρήσιμο και βολικό κι αν είναι, έχει ορισμένα ζητήματα ασφάλειας που πρέπει να επιλυθούν. Εάν θέλετε να προστατεύσετε το διαδικτυακό σας απόρρητο, θα πρέπει πιθανώς να εξετάσετε το ενδεχόμενο να απενεργοποιήσετε το WebRTC στο πρόγραμμα περιήγησής σας.
Και αν χρησιμοποιείτε VPN, βεβαιωθείτε ότι κάνει καλή δουλειά προστατεύοντάς σας από διαφορετικούς τύπους διαρροών. Ωστόσο, η προστασία από διαρροές δεν είναι η μόνη δυνατότητα που πρέπει να αναζητήσετε όταν επιλέγετε έναν πάροχο VPN, επομένως κάντε την έρευνά σας ανάλογα πριν λάβετε σημαντικές αποφάσεις.